J B Hunt Transport Services Inc's stock rose by 3.02%, reaching a 20-day high during regular trading hours.
This increase comes as the broader market shows strength, with the Nasdaq-100 up 0.43% and the S&P 500 up 0.07%.
The positive market sentiment may reflect investor confidence in the transportation sector, contributing to J B Hunt's strong performance.
Analyst Views on JBHT
Wall Street analysts forecast JBHT stock price to fall over the next 12 months. According to Wall Street analysts, the average 1-year price target for JBHT is 197.77 USD with a low forecast of 150.00 USD and a high forecast of 240.00 USD. However, analyst price targets are subjective and often lag stock prices, so investors should focus on the objective reasons behind analyst rating changes, which better reflect the company's fundamentals.

About JBHT
J.B. Hunt Transport Services, Inc. is a surface transportation, delivery, and logistics company in North America. The Company, through its wholly owned subsidiaries, provides a range of transportation, brokerage, and delivery services to a diverse group of customers and consumers throughout the continental United States, Canada, and Mexico. It operates through five segments: Intermodal (JBI), Dedicated Contract Services (DCS), Integrated Capacity Solutions (ICS), Final Mile Services (FMS) and Truckload (JBT). JBI segment includes freight that is transported by rail over at least some portion of the movement and also includes certain repositioning truck freight moved by JBI equipment or third-party carriers. DCS segment focuses on private fleet conversion and creation of replenishment and specialized equipment. ICS segment provides non-asset and asset-light transportation solutions to customers through relationships with third-party carriers and integration with Company-owned equipment.
